Post by bart »

a few replies:

- the tabs and multiple effects will be midi controlable
- openGL excellerated rendering is not an option yet because then all rendering is done on the videocard and to then get that data back to the system memory for streaming on the network or harddisk recording is very slooowww
-v2 requires the same hardware as v1.51 does
-network streaming is in theory possible over the internet but it requires a LOT of bandwith because we are sending raw videoframes over the network ... this bandwith is not a problem on a LAN
-the three boxes on the left are the 3 possible effect slots .. these are only vissible with a 1280 minimum screen resolution ... on 1024 the three effect slots are tabbed above the file browser
- we love the gray/pink colour palette and we like a bit of controversy ;-)
